Transaction 21c60a2250df4119b676192594e0628df2a1d0dbf9a6e39a995c01656d8bb80f

1 Input
2 Outputs
  • 21c60a2250df4119b676192594e0628df2a1d0dbf9a6e39a995c01656d8bb80f:0
  • value  1249201
    address  39t25hn2xQuJ9EiUuwytDYHrnGMfKmVrmA
  • 21c60a2250df4119b676192594e0628df2a1d0dbf9a6e39a995c01656d8bb80f:1
  • value  31760270
    address  34vdwZqGR6sPGh2S4Fnge5YJFS79Cr8TMW